ST. MARY’S BAY, N.L. — The mayor of a small community on Newfoundland’s Avalon Peninsula has called the poaching charges against him unfounded, reports a recent CBC News story.

Melvin Careen, the mayor of St. Mary’s Bay at Point Lance, was charged in August with poaching salmon, but he told the CBC he found the 43 fish in question at the side of a pond.

According to the CBC report, Careen is not planning to step down from his volunteer role as mayor. The matter is set to go to trial on Nov. 9.
